Vanessa Redgrave

Synopsis
Television arts documentary series. Profile and interview with Vanessa Redgrave. Vanessa Redgrave talks to Melvyn Bragg about her father Michael Redgrave and her mother, Rachel Kempson. She speaks of her early life, her aesthetic choices in building a character and a production of Brecht’s Galileo with Ekkehard Schall when Brecht was in exile. Includes a specially recorded performance of an extract from Antony and Cleopatra and a scene between King Lear and Cordelia, played by Vanessa and Michael Redgrave,
